Abstract

本发明公开了一种调光微晶防眩读写专用灯,包括烤漆铝材边框,所述烤漆铝材边框内侧上部设置有上槽;所述烤漆铝材边框内侧下部设置有下槽;所述烤漆铝材边框外侧底部设置有底槽;所述下槽内侧嵌有微晶防眩光面板;所述微晶防眩光面板顶面固定有高透光扩散板;所述高透光扩散板顶面贴合有高透光亚克力导光板;所述烤漆铝材边框于上槽内侧固定有LED灯板;所述LED灯板和透光亚克力导光板之间压合有高反射率反光筒;本发明的调光微晶防眩读写专用灯,结构简单,组装方便,能够使有效光高效扩散通过,有害光进行过滤,并通过微晶防眩光面板进行防眩设计,光线柔和无频闪,光照区域细腻均匀从而保证用眼舒适,能够很好地防止炫光,保护学生眼睛。

Description

一种调光微晶防眩读写专用灯
技术领域
本发明涉及一种读写专用灯,特别涉及一种调光微晶防眩读写专用灯,属于读写专用灯技术领域。
背景技术
LED灯是一块电致发光的半导体材料芯片,用银胶或白胶固化到支架上,然后用银线或金线连接芯片和电路板,四周用环氧树脂密封,起到保护内部芯线的作用,最后安装外壳,随着LED技术的发展,LED芯片的辐射亮度大幅提高,再者由于 LED光线产生的极端的亮度对比,所带来的眩光污染及视觉残留会严重的影响到我们视力健康及生理反应,降低了我们的工作及生活的质量;特别是容易影响读写等学习照明,另外,现有的读写灯安装难度大。
发明内容
为解决上述问题,本发明提出了一种调光微晶防眩读写专用灯,能够使有效光高效扩散通过,有害光进行过滤,并通过微晶防眩光面板进行防眩设计。
本发明的调光微晶防眩读写专用灯,包括烤漆铝材边框,所述烤漆铝材边框内侧上部设置有上槽;所述烤漆铝材边框内侧下部设置有下槽;所述烤漆铝材边框外侧底部设置有底槽;烤漆铝材边框加工简单方便,从而给整个灯体部件通过安装和支撑,安装简单方便,内部部件采用压合嵌合方式,外部部件直接通过螺栓压紧即可完成组装;所述下槽内侧嵌有微晶防眩光面板;所述微晶防眩光面板顶面固定有高透光扩散板;所述高透光扩散板顶面贴合有高透光亚克力导光板;所述烤漆铝材边框于上槽内侧固定有LED灯板;所述LED灯板和透光亚克力导光板之间压合有高反射率反光筒;LED灯板发射的照明光源,通过高反射率反光筒进行光线直射和反射,将照明光源通过高透光扩散板进行光线扩散和高透光亚克力导光板进行高透光和送光;最后通过微晶防眩光面板将光线导出;所述高反射率反光筒外表面与烤漆铝材边框内边沿贴合;所述底槽内嵌有底面压边;所述底面压边与微晶防眩光面板底面外沿压合;烤漆铝材边框顶面设置有与LED灯板压合的镀锌防锈后盖板。
进一步地,所述镀锌防锈后盖板和底面压边通过螺栓与烤漆铝材边框固定,通过镀锌防锈后盖板和底面压边将照明件和导光件压制于烤漆铝材边框内。
进一步地,所述烤漆铝材边框外侧开设有与安装位卡接的边槽。
进一步地,所述底面压边内沿为坡面结构。
进一步地,所述LED灯板和镀锌防锈后盖板之间设置有防压保护棉层。
进一步地,所述底面压边与微晶防眩光面板之间设置有防水黏胶。
进一步地,所述高透光亚克力导光板和LED灯板之间设置有蓝光滤片,通过蓝光滤片将蓝光过滤。
本发明与现有技术相比较,本发明的调光微晶防眩读写专用灯,结构简单,组装方便,能够使有效光高效扩散通过,有害光进行过滤,并通过微晶防眩光面板进行防眩设计,光线柔和无频闪,光照区域细腻均匀从而保证用眼舒适,能够很好地防止炫光,保护学生眼睛。

具体实施方式
实施例1:
如图1和图2所示的调光微晶防眩读写专用灯,包括烤漆铝材边框1,所述烤漆铝材边框1内侧上部设置有上槽2;所述烤漆铝材边框1内侧下部设置有下槽3;所述烤漆铝材边框1外侧底部设置有底槽4;烤漆铝材边框加工简单方便,从而给整个灯体部件通过安装和支撑,安装简单方便,内部部件采用压合嵌合方式,外部部件直接通过螺栓压紧即可完成组装;所述下槽3内侧嵌有微晶防眩光面板5;所述微晶防眩光面板5顶面固定有高透光扩散板6;所述高透光扩散板6顶面贴合有高透光亚克力导光板7;所述烤漆铝材边框1于上槽内侧固定有LED灯板8;所述LED灯板8和透光亚克力导光板7之间压合有高反射率反光筒9;LED灯板发射的照明光源,通过高反射率反光筒进行光线直射和反射,将照明光源通过高透光扩散板进行光线扩散和高透光亚克力导光板进行高透光和送光;最后通过微晶防眩光面板将光线导出;所述高反射率反光筒9外表面与烤漆铝材边框1内边沿贴合;所述底槽4内嵌有底面压边10;所述底面压边10与微晶防眩光面板5底面外沿压合;烤漆铝材边框1顶面设置有与LED灯板8压合的镀锌防锈后盖板11。
其中,所述镀锌防锈后盖板11和底面压边10通过螺栓与烤漆铝材边框1固定,通过镀锌防锈后盖板和底面压边将照明件和导光件压制于烤漆铝材边框内。所述烤漆铝材边框1外侧开设有与安装位卡接的边槽12。所述底面压边10内沿为坡面结构。所述LED灯板8和镀锌防锈后盖板11之间设置有防压保护棉层。所述底面压边10与微晶防眩光面板5之间设置有防水黏胶。
如图3所示,再一实施例中,所述高透光亚克力导光板7和LED灯板8之间设置有蓝光滤片13,通过蓝光滤片将蓝光过滤。
